A Registered Nurse (RN) in a long-term care (LTC) facility provides skilled nursing care to residents, ensuring their health, comfort, and well-being. RNs oversee patient care plans, administer treatments, monitor for changes in condition, and collaborate with healthcare teams to provide high-quality, resident-centered care. They also play a key role in supervising nursing staff, educating residents and families, and ensuring compliance with healthcare regulations and facility policies.

The Emergency Room Registered Nurse (ER RN) delivers rapid-response, high-quality patient care in a fast-paced emergency department setting. This role involves assessing patient conditions, implementing urgent care plans, administering life-saving treatments, and collaborating with multidisciplinary healthcare teams to ensure high-quality, efficient, patient-centered care in critical situations. The ER RN demonstrates strong clinical skills, exceptional critical thinking abilities, excellent communication under pressure, and a commitment to maintaining the highest standards of patient safety and professional ethics.

Position Overview:
The professional nurse in critical care uses the nursing process to plan, implement, evaluate and document patient care. The professional nurse considers the patient s physical, psychosocial, cultural, spiritual, language barriers, age, teaching needs, and readiness to learn. The professional nurse involves the interdisciplinary team in the plan of care and patient intervention. The RN II independently cares for two (2) critically ill patients and can master most 1:1 acuity patients, cares for patients on a ventilator, understands basic dysrhythmia and hemodynamic status of the patient while correlating readings to the care of the patient. The RN II assists with bedside procedures and administers medications prescribed by the physician according to policy. The RN II uses an autonomous practice. The RN II independently anticipates professional responsibilities and accepts accountability for professional actions. The RN II uses critical thinking skills in daily practice.

Job Objective:
Determines the appropriateness of hospital admission, and advocates, coordinates and facilitates the interdisciplinary plan of care to expedite medically appropriate, effective, efficient and timely utilization of resources for maximum patient outcomes. Partners with the charge nurse, social worker, physician and other members of the interdisciplinary team to facilitate safe and timely discharge, and intervenes as appropriate to remove barriers to efficient patient throughput and smooth patient transition. Applies clinical expertise and medical appropriateness criteria to resource utilization, admissions and discharge planning.

The Helper Bees partners with insurance carriers and health plans to provide quality care and the right tools to keep older adults independent, healthy, and at home longer. We invite you to consider our per diem opportunity to earn supplemental income as an Independent Contracted Nurse. The assessments are completed face to face in the claimant's homes.
* This is a 1099 contract position to earn supplemental income. You will need a portable computer with Windows or tablet with camera.
* In this role, you will complete in-depth cognitive and functional assessments with clients in their homes.
* You will complete structured assessments, focusing on accuracy and efficiency.
* You will be focused on observing and reporting the current status of the individual. You must remain objective.
* You will coordinate all scheduling with client or their point of contact using contact information provided to you.
* You will submit an assessment within 24 hours through an online application. Upon submission, our review team will reach out with any needed clarifications by telephone within 48 hours. An assessment is not considered complete until all clarifications are answered.
* You will be paid $125 per assessment within a 35 mile radius, upon completion of each assessment.

A professional nurse who possesses and demonstrates clinical skills and knowledge appropriate for the care of the patient undergoing any imaging procedure at Eisenhower Imaging Center. Utilizes the nursing process to plan, direct and coordinate care for a safe experience. Ensures that all patients' needs are met and evaluates/monitors delivery of nursing care.
Essential Job Functions:
Starts IV safely and competently in addition to managing and treating IV infiltrations
Performs pre-procedure assessments, preparation and post-procedure care.
Provides timely, accurate and precise reporting of any change in patient condition to the radiologist.
Appropriately assesses, treats, and manages patients for contrast allergies, renal function, diabetes, claustrophobia, etc.
Administers and documents medications, ensuring patient safety following Federal guidelines.
Co-manages the care of all outpatients/inpatients PET/CTs to include scheduling, interviewing, preparation and transportation.
Assists all technologists in the care of any patient with special needs.
Assists technologist or other center personnel in managing patients through each modality as needed.
Orders all supplies related to the Imaging Center as assigned and appropriate.
Manages medical emergencies under the guidance of the radiologists.
Maintains all nursing and medical emergency equipment. Monitors oxygen supply.
Demonstrates implementation skills in accordance with EIC Standards of Care, policies, procedures, and Nurse Practice Act.
Demonstrates competency in the operation of equipment specific to clinical area.
Utilizes the nursing process of assessment, planning, implementation and evaluation when delivering nursing care.
Participates in development and evaluation of patient care related policy and procedures.
Practices accurate and timely completion of scheduled and unscheduled work to maximize productivity.
Adheres to radiation safety guidelines under the direction of the technologists and/or radiologists.
Provide for patient care; comfort, safety and patient confidentiality.
